Ultrasound Finds Unexpected Lubrication Problems

While testing bearings at a major mid east cereal manufacturer high ultrasound readings were recorded on one of 7 cookers. After lubricating the bearing with the prescribed amount of grease the ultrasound readings did not change. The machine was flagged for service and the bearings changed out.

Later it was discovered that the thickener had separated from the grease and clogged the cage preventing new grease from reaching the rolling elements of the bearing.

The bottom line: don’t assume that applying grease to a bearing will solve a problem, monitor and measure to be sure and investigate issues that stand out.
